How they compare

Israel currently reports 2.09 million immigrants against 2.06 million immigrants in Uganda, a difference of 33,810 immigrants.

Across all 8 years both countries report, Israel has been ahead every year.

Israel ranks 36th and Uganda ranks 38th of 232 countries.

Israel has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Israel Uganda Difference Ahead
1990s 1.70 million immigrants 613,390 immigrants 1.09 million immigrants Israel
2000s 1.86 million immigrants 630,946 immigrants 1.23 million immigrants Israel
2010s 1.99 million immigrants 669,118 immigrants 1.32 million immigrants Israel
2020s 2.08 million immigrants 1.92 million immigrants 163,300 immigrants Israel

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
